Dominguez Hills, Bakersfield to Meet in CCAA Tournament

The Cal State Dominguez Hills men’s basketball team will make its first appearance since the 1988-89 season in the California Collegiate Athletic Assn. postseason tournament when it plays Cal State Bakersfield in a first-round game at 5:45 p.m. today at Riverside City College.

Dominguez Hills (16-11) finished third in the conference and Bakersfield (21-6) was second. Top-seeded UC Riverside (22-4) will play Cal Poly Pomona (15-12) in the tournament’s other game. The winners meet for the tournament title and a berth in the NCAA Division II playoffs at 7:30 p.m. Saturday.

The Division II playoffs begin next week.

Bakersfield beat Dominguez Hills, 50-37, in January--the lowest point total ever for the Toros. Dominguez Hills beat Bakersfield, 64-60, in February.

Bakersfield has a history of success in postseason play. The Roadrunners, who have competed in the Division II playoffs the past four seasons, reached the semifinals the past two seasons and were runners-up in 1990.

Bakersfield has been led by senior forward Beau Redstone and guards Kenny Warren, a sophomore, and Fred Eckles, a senior. Redstone averages a team-leading 13.8 points and 10.1 rebounds, Eckles averages 12.8 points and a team-high of 4.3 assists, and Warren averages 10.7 points.

Senior forward Michael Moore continues to lead the Toros with averages of 11.4 points and 4.6 rebounds. Dominguez Hills’ best rebounder is sophomore forward John Brown, who averages 5.3.

In the Lions’ 71-59 loss to Pepperdine on Wednesday night in Malibu, Loyola Marymount’s Joelle Longobardi became the fourth women’s basketball player in school history to score 1,000 or more points.

Longobardi had 15 points in the loss and finished with 1,012 in her career. Lynn Flanagan is Loyola’s career-scoring leader with 1,436 points.

The Lions (6-21) finished the season winless in 14 West Coast Conference games and have lost 15 consecutive league games dating from last season.
